Output 831859a41ade1b9c9069661b5ce1a27e18bf8b2618fe08e8114c95f05a6e580c:1

value
118379600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a82e268b95f7f802349e5d56f50ae551e55d94d OP_EQUAL
address
372PugHfr1ztEsduTkCQ6YSf2Tw7s55Bq8
transaction
831859a41ade1b9c9069661b5ce1a27e18bf8b2618fe08e8114c95f05a6e580c
spent
true